Output 6314a20fd48f28b7090b1e34732017244f0f40dd929e3fe480fb2aa612b42b27:1

value
16094160
script pubkey
OP_0 OP_PUSHBYTES_20 20fc0abf8b1c04c62a9afeafd3cfbe0729b068fe
address
bc1qyr7q40utrszvv256l6ha8na7qu5mq6876mgvq0
transaction
6314a20fd48f28b7090b1e34732017244f0f40dd929e3fe480fb2aa612b42b27
confirmations
136453
spent
true